DBA Data[Home] [Help]

APPS.BEN_CWB_EMP_ELIG dependencies on BEN_CWB_PERSON_RATES_API

Line 158: ben_cwb_person_rates_api.update_person_rate

154: IF p_pl_elig_flag = 'Y' THEN
155: OPEN c_person_rate(p_o1_person_rate_id);
156: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
157: CLOSE c_person_rate;
158: ben_cwb_person_rates_api.update_person_rate
159: (
160: p_group_per_in_ler_id => p_group_per_in_ler_id
161: ,p_pl_id => p_o1_pl_id
162: ,p_oipl_id => p_o1_oipl_id

Line 184: ben_cwb_person_rates_api.update_person_rate

180: ELSE
181: l_inelig_rsn_cd := NULL;
182: l_ws_start_date := hr_api.g_date;
183: END IF;
184: ben_cwb_person_rates_api.update_person_rate
185: (
186: p_group_per_in_ler_id => p_group_per_in_ler_id
187: ,p_pl_id => p_o1_pl_id
188: ,p_oipl_id => p_o1_oipl_id

Line 202: ben_cwb_person_rates_api.update_person_rate

198: OPEN c_person_rate(p_pl_person_rate_id);
199: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
200: CLOSE c_person_rate;
201: IF l_elig_flag = 'N' AND p_o1_elig_flag = 'Y' THEN
202: ben_cwb_person_rates_api.update_person_rate
203: (
204: p_group_per_in_ler_id => p_group_per_in_ler_id
205: ,p_pl_id => p_pl_pl_id
206: ,p_oipl_id => p_pl_oipl_id

Line 232: ben_cwb_person_rates_api.update_person_rate

228: IF p_pl_elig_flag = 'Y' THEN
229: OPEN c_person_rate(p_o2_person_rate_id);
230: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
231: CLOSE c_person_rate;
232: ben_cwb_person_rates_api.update_person_rate
233: (
234: p_group_per_in_ler_id => p_group_per_in_ler_id
235: ,p_pl_id => p_o2_pl_id
236: ,p_oipl_id => p_o2_oipl_id

Line 258: ben_cwb_person_rates_api.update_person_rate

254: ELSE
255: l_inelig_rsn_cd := NULL;
256: l_ws_start_date := hr_api.g_date;
257: END IF;
258: ben_cwb_person_rates_api.update_person_rate
259: (
260: p_group_per_in_ler_id => p_group_per_in_ler_id
261: ,p_pl_id => p_o2_pl_id
262: ,p_oipl_id => p_o2_oipl_id

Line 276: ben_cwb_person_rates_api.update_person_rate

272: OPEN c_person_rate(p_pl_person_rate_id);
273: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
274: CLOSE c_person_rate;
275: IF l_elig_flag = 'N' AND p_o2_elig_flag = 'Y' THEN
276: ben_cwb_person_rates_api.update_person_rate
277: (
278: p_group_per_in_ler_id => p_group_per_in_ler_id
279: ,p_pl_id => p_pl_pl_id
280: ,p_oipl_id => p_pl_oipl_id

Line 306: ben_cwb_person_rates_api.update_person_rate

302: IF p_pl_elig_flag = 'Y' THEN
303: OPEN c_person_rate(p_o3_person_rate_id);
304: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
305: CLOSE c_person_rate;
306: ben_cwb_person_rates_api.update_person_rate
307: (
308: p_group_per_in_ler_id => p_group_per_in_ler_id
309: ,p_pl_id => p_o3_pl_id
310: ,p_oipl_id => p_o3_oipl_id

Line 332: ben_cwb_person_rates_api.update_person_rate

328: ELSE
329: l_inelig_rsn_cd := NULL;
330: l_ws_start_date := hr_api.g_date;
331: END IF;
332: ben_cwb_person_rates_api.update_person_rate
333: (
334: p_group_per_in_ler_id => p_group_per_in_ler_id
335: ,p_pl_id => p_o3_pl_id
336: ,p_oipl_id => p_o3_oipl_id

Line 350: ben_cwb_person_rates_api.update_person_rate

346: OPEN c_person_rate(p_pl_person_rate_id);
347: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
348: CLOSE c_person_rate;
349: IF l_elig_flag = 'N' AND p_o3_elig_flag = 'Y' THEN
350: ben_cwb_person_rates_api.update_person_rate
351: (
352: p_group_per_in_ler_id => p_group_per_in_ler_id
353: ,p_pl_id => p_pl_pl_id
354: ,p_oipl_id => p_pl_oipl_id

Line 380: ben_cwb_person_rates_api.update_person_rate

376: IF p_pl_elig_flag = 'Y' THEN
377: OPEN c_person_rate(p_o4_person_rate_id);
378: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
379: CLOSE c_person_rate;
380: ben_cwb_person_rates_api.update_person_rate
381: (
382: p_group_per_in_ler_id => p_group_per_in_ler_id
383: ,p_pl_id => p_o4_pl_id
384: ,p_oipl_id => p_o4_oipl_id

Line 406: ben_cwb_person_rates_api.update_person_rate

402: ELSE
403: l_inelig_rsn_cd := NULL;
404: l_ws_start_date := hr_api.g_date;
405: END IF;
406: ben_cwb_person_rates_api.update_person_rate
407: (
408: p_group_per_in_ler_id => p_group_per_in_ler_id
409: ,p_pl_id => p_o4_pl_id
410: ,p_oipl_id => p_o4_oipl_id

Line 424: ben_cwb_person_rates_api.update_person_rate

420: OPEN c_person_rate(p_pl_person_rate_id);
421: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
422: CLOSE c_person_rate;
423: IF l_elig_flag = 'N' AND p_o4_elig_flag = 'Y' THEN
424: ben_cwb_person_rates_api.update_person_rate
425: (
426: p_group_per_in_ler_id => p_group_per_in_ler_id
427: ,p_pl_id => p_pl_pl_id
428: ,p_oipl_id => p_pl_oipl_id

Line 456: ben_cwb_person_rates_api.update_person_rate

452: -- Need to call the routine which deletes all assignment changes
453: -- as the person becomes ineligible.
454: END IF;
455:
456: ben_cwb_person_rates_api.update_person_rate
457: (
458: p_group_per_in_ler_id => p_group_per_in_ler_id
459: ,p_pl_id => p_pl_pl_id
460: ,p_oipl_id => p_pl_oipl_id

Line 481: ben_cwb_person_rates_api.update_person_rate

477: IF p_o1_oipl_id IS NOT NULL THEN
478: OPEN c_person_rate(p_o1_person_rate_id);
479: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
480: CLOSE c_person_rate;
481: ben_cwb_person_rates_api.update_person_rate
482: (
483: p_group_per_in_ler_id => p_group_per_in_ler_id
484: ,p_pl_id => p_o1_pl_id
485: ,p_oipl_id => p_o1_oipl_id

Line 504: ben_cwb_person_rates_api.update_person_rate

500: IF p_o2_oipl_id IS NOT NULL THEN
501: OPEN c_person_rate(p_o2_person_rate_id);
502: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
503: CLOSE c_person_rate;
504: ben_cwb_person_rates_api.update_person_rate
505: (
506: p_group_per_in_ler_id => p_group_per_in_ler_id
507: ,p_pl_id => p_o2_pl_id
508: ,p_oipl_id => p_o2_oipl_id

Line 527: ben_cwb_person_rates_api.update_person_rate

523: IF p_o3_oipl_id IS NOT NULL THEN
524: OPEN c_person_rate(p_o3_person_rate_id);
525: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
526: CLOSE c_person_rate;
527: ben_cwb_person_rates_api.update_person_rate
528: (
529: p_group_per_in_ler_id => p_group_per_in_ler_id
530: ,p_pl_id => p_o3_pl_id
531: ,p_oipl_id => p_o3_oipl_id

Line 550: ben_cwb_person_rates_api.update_person_rate

546: IF p_o4_oipl_id IS NOT NULL THEN
547: OPEN c_person_rate(p_o4_person_rate_id);
548: FETCH c_person_rate INTO l_object_version_number, l_ws_val,l_elig_flag,l_ws_start_date;
549: CLOSE c_person_rate;
550: ben_cwb_person_rates_api.update_person_rate
551: (
552: p_group_per_in_ler_id => p_group_per_in_ler_id
553: ,p_pl_id => p_o4_pl_id
554: ,p_oipl_id => p_o4_oipl_id